Eligibility
To be eligible for the Chevening Energy Market Reform Fellowship, applicants must meet the following criteria: Nationality and Residence: The fellowship is open exclusively to Chinese nationals who intend to return to China after completing the fellowship. Professional Experience: Applicants must have at least five years of meaningful professional experience in the energy sector. This includes individuals currently employed or enrolled as PhD candidates (excluding PhDs from UK, EU, or USA universities). Academic Qualifications: A postgraduate-level qualification (or equivalent professional training) in a relevant field is required. Employment Restrictions: Applicants must not be an employee or relative of His Majesty's Government, the FCDO, or other specified UK government bodies within the last two years of the application date. Furthermore, applicants must not hold dual nationality where one nationality is British. Chevening Partner Employment: Applicants employed by Chevening Partner organizations within the last two years are eligible to apply but cannot receive a partner award from their affiliated organization. Additionally, individuals who have previously benefited from UK government-funded scholarships are eligible after a five-year period following the completion of their prior award. Applicants are expected to demonstrate career progression and leadership in their fields since receiving their previous award.

Benefits
The Chevening Energy Market Reform Fellowship offers a comprehensive package of benefits to ensure fellows can focus entirely on their research and professional development. The benefits include: Full programme fees covering all academic costs associated with the fellowship Living expenses for the duration of the fellowship, ensuring fellows can focus on their studies without financial worries Return economy airfare from China to the UK Access to a CEPMLP supervisor who will support research activities Full access to classes, lectures, and seminars at CEPMLP, enabling fellows to enrich their research and academic experience Cultural events and networking opportunities organized by the FCDO and the Chevening Secretariat

Application Procedure
Applications for the Chevening Energy Market Reform Fellowship 2025-2026 are now open, with a deadline set for 5 November 2024. Below is the timeline for the fellowship application and selection process: Applications Open: 6 August 2024 Application Deadline: 5 November 2024 Sifting of Applications: From 6 November 2024 Reading Committee Assessments: Mid-November 2024 to January 2025 Shortlisting of Candidates for Interview: Mid-February 2025 Deadline for References and Education Documents: 19 February 2025 Interview Period: 26 February to 25 April 2025 Results Announcement: From May 2025 Fellowship Commencement: September to December 2025 How to Apply Interested candidates should apply directly through the Chevening Fellowships portal before the deadline. The application requires submission of a detailed proposal outlining the candidate’s research goals and the relevance of their experience to energy market reform. Shortlisted candidates will be invited for interviews at the British Embassy or High Commission in China.
